The script version of "Little Women" captures the essence of Louisa May Alcott's beloved novel, focusing on the lives and struggles of the four March sisters—Meg, Jo, Beth, and Amy—as they navigate the challenges of adolescence, family, and societal expectations during the Civil War era. It emphasizes themes of love, ambition, and the pursuit of personal identity, while showcasing the sisters' distinct personalities and their relationships with each other and their mother. The dialogue and stage directions aim to bring the characters' emotional depth and the novel's timeless messages to life in a dynamic format.
